Liability in case of forest fires

A “forest weather forecast” is now broadcast every day by Météo France to raise public awareness of possible fire outbreaks in the territory.

franceinfo: What do we risk if we start a fire? Are the penalties generally very heavy?

Philippe Duport: Yes, for someone who would make a fire in his garden, while he or she knows the municipal decree which prohibits fires in the municipality, the maximum penalty is two years in prison and a fine of 30,000 euros. . When it comes to the involuntary fire of wood, forests, moors, maquis, plantations or reforestation of others, since the law of 2004, the penalties have been increased. They are increased, there too, to two years in prison and a fine of 30,000 euros.

Is it worse if the fire is intentional?

Yes, there, the maximum sentences go up again. The arsonist risks up to 10 years in prison and a fine of 150,000 euros. And if the intentional fire led to the death of others, we go up to life imprisonment.

And watch out for cigarette butts!

Yes, the measure is very recent: it is no longer possible to smoke in the woods and forests, during periods of fire risk, and even up to 200 meters from these areas. The new law explicitly includes the throwing of cigarette butts, among the causes that can “involuntarily cause the burning of woods and forests”.

For the most serious cases, those which have resulted in the death of one or more people, the criminal penalties can reach 10 years in prison and a fine of 150,000 euros. In addition, a person who has suffered damage, whose house has been destroyed for example, will be able to file a complaint and seek compensation.

Landowners also have an obligation to clear brush?

Yes, this obligation has just been reinforced. In areas located in territories at risk of fire, and departments where woods and forests are particularly exposed, there is a legal obligation to clear brush.

Owners must clear their land, and if they do not, they risk a fine of 50 euros per square meter. If the fact of not having cleared the brush has allowed the spread of a fire which has destroyed the property of others, you risk up to one year in prison and a fine of 15,000 euros.
